| name | code-explorer |
| description | Survey a codebase area before changing it. Maps file tree, traces dependencies, identifies idioms. |
| when_to_use | User asks "where is X" or "how does Y work" or before any non-trivial change. |
Build a small, accurate mental model of a codebase area before touching it. Don't modify anything — this skill is read-only.
